  2. Polite and courteous B1 formal

    Behaving in a polite, reasonable, and respectful way.

    • They had a civil conversation despite their differences.
    • Please try to be civil to your guests.
    • He gave a civil reply to the criticism.

  3. Relating to law B2 formal

    Concerning legal matters between individuals or organizations, not criminal.

    • She filed a civil lawsuit against the company.
    • The case is being heard in a civil court.
    • Civil law deals with disputes between private parties.
